Enjoy "The Best Steak... Anywhere" at Morton's The Steakhouse. An upscale, fine dining destination offering prime-aged steaks, seafood, happy hour, cocktails, wine dinners, and more. Conveniently located in Downtown Jacksonville at the Hyatt Regency Jacksonville Riverfront, Morton's covered patio and elegant private dining rooms are ideal for larger or smaller groups.

    It was our first time at Morton's and will most likely be our last. The food OK with the standouts being the the oysters - both raw and Rockefeller - and the desert. We've had better steaks, sides, and seafood at other restaurants in Jacksonville at much lower prices. Restaurant management did not enforce the dress code which explicitly prohibits hoodies and tank tops, but both could be seen on patrons at the bar to the left of the entrance off the hotel lobby. My husband had to return sweet tea 3 times in a row - he only drinks unsweet tea. Our server was pleasant, but it seemed her main focus was on upselling food - once it was served, she was nowhere to be found. As a whole, the dining experience was not worth the nearly $400 tab.
